Planning commission backs facade deviation for Taco Bell 'Kitchen X' prototype at Lamar's Landing

Summary

The Newcastle Planning Commission recommended approval of a facade deviation for a proposed Taco Bell using the chain's Kitchen X prototype, despite local masonry requirements. Staff supported the deviation and the commission voted unanimously to recommend approval subject to standard permitting.

The Newcastle Planning Commission on Monday recommended approval of a facade deviation for a proposed Taco Bell at Lot 2C of Lamar’s Landing, a development that fronts State Highway 9.
